COMMON NAME: Lemon Grass.
BOTANICAL NAME: Cymbopogon citratus.
HABIT: An elegant, thick stemmed, clumping grass. Eventually weeps over itself.
HEIGHT: In really warm zones it can get up to 2 metres.
WIDTH: Clumps out to about 800mm.
CLIMATE INFO: Grows everywhere, however it does its best in warm to hot areas with good access to regular water.
GARDEN USES: Due to its weeping habit it can be used as a decorative grass in the garden.
CULINARY USES: The crushed stems give off a deliciously fresh zesty lemon flavour.
